Brief Life History of Joseph Smith

When Joseph Smith Grow was born on 21 September 1849, in Saint Joseph, Buchanan, Missouri, United States, his father, Henry Grow Jr, was 31 and his mother, Nancy Ann Elliott, was 34. He married Eva Jane Redfield on 2 January 1871, in Salt Lake City, Salt Lake, Utah, United States. They were the parents of at least 7 sons and 3 daughters. He lived in Salt Lake, Utah, United States for about 10 years and Portland, Multnomah, Oregon, United States in 1930. He died on 8 March 1932, in Panamá, Panama, Panama, at the age of 82, and was buried in Corozal American Cemetery And Memorial, Ancón, Panamá, Panama, Panama.
